Paper Mill Trail

This is the print view for this trail. View the full trail posting.

This paved trail follows what was once Paper Mill Road and provides smooth, easy walking and biking along the Sabattus River. The northern half of the trail passes through gently rolling, open fields.

Description

The Paper Mill trail provides a gentle walking or biking experience along the Sabattus River under a canopy of oaks, pines, and occasional apple or poplar. There are many opportunities to enjoy the the river on the southern portion of the current trail or the rolling fields of the northern section.

The kiosk at the Sebattus River boat launch and another historical sign along the trail provide the historical background of the area, the more recent history of the trail, and information about other outdoor opportunities in Lisbon.

Other Information

Future plans for the trail include extending a section further south to follow the Androscoggin River towards Lisbon Falls.

Trailhead Information

This trail can be access at either end or in the middle via the Lisbon Community School.

The current southern trailhead is located along the ME Route 96 and Frost Hill Avenue intersection in Lisbon. The Sabattus River boat launch and parking lot is also located here.

The Lisbon Community School is located off Mill Street 0.3 miles from ME Route 196. The trail passes by the parking area at the end of the access road.

From the northern end, there is a small park and parking at St. Ann Street. Follow the sidewalk on Upland Road. This soon becomes leaves the road to become the trail.
